Oasis named new drummer

17.05.2008 00:00
Oasis named new drummerChris Sharrock, who previously worked with Robbie Williams, joined Oasis. He replaced Zak Starkey, son of The Beatles member Ringo Starr. Starkey left Oasis after his falling-out with the band’s leader Noel Gallagher.

Oasis spokeperson explained: «Robbie Williams went on strike because of his conflict with record label, and Chris has had enough of sitting and not playing music».

Ironically, Oasis frontman Noel Gallagher once dismissed Robbie Williams as «the fat dancer from Take That».
